Before the hiring blitz, Brookside's one full-time officer and several part-timers patrolled the city and its stretch of Interstate 22, writing tickets worth about $82,467 in fines. The resignations include former chief Mike Jones, who built the tiny towns department from a one-man agency in 2018 to one that, according to data the town provided to AL.com in response to a public records request, included 13 full time officers and two reserves. AL.com in January reported how Brookside used fines and forfeitures to bring in almost half the town revenue in 2020, and how its police department grew exponentially under Chief Jones.
